Pilot Operating Handbook for the C42 Series
POH C42 SERIES ISSUE1 (B) REV7 25/04/2020 Page 55 of 73
c.) Control Surface Deflections
Note: The angle of the aileron bottom relative to the
wing chord is -5° (tangent front to rear spar). It is
defined by the length of the aileron push rods.
-
Distance from axis of rotation
Aileron
Neutral position: -7°± 1° -35mm ± 10mm
Upwards: 20°± 2° 90mm ± 10mm
Downwards: 14°± 2° 70mm ± 10mm
Measuring point distance from the steering axis: 250mm
Spade settings on the aileron in the C42C and C42CS model.
Spade angle in relation to the QR-bottom +3° ± 1°
Measurement with water level at base of 1 cm under Aileron end strip.

iKarus C42 Specifications

General IconGeneral
ManufacturerComco Ikarus
TypeUltralight Aircraft
EngineRotax 912
Cruise Speed160 km/h
Stall Speed65 km/h
Seats2
Height2.3 m
Maximum Takeoff Weight472.5 kg
Range800 km
Service Ceiling4000 m
Power Output80 hp
Rate of Climb5 m/s
